Ingredients You’ll Need

To make Giada De Laurentiis’ Chocolate-Hazelnut Ravioli, you’ll need the following ingredients:

For the dough: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il

For the filling:

  • 1 cup chocolate-hazelnut spread (such as Nutella)
  • 1/2 cup mascarpone cheese
  • 1/4 cup powdered s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ract

For the garnish:

  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 1/4 cup cocoa powder

Preparing the Dough

Step 1: Combine dry ingredients

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our and salt. Create a well in the center of the mixture.

Step 2: Add wet ingredients

Crack the eggs into the well and add the extra-virgin olive oil. Use a fork to gently beat the eggs and oil together, gradually incorporating the flour mixture.

Step 3: Knead the dough

Once the dough starts coming together, use your hands to knead it for about 10 minutes. You should have a smooth and elastic dough. Cover the dough with plastic wrap and let it rest for 30 minutes at room temperature.

Preparing the Filling

Step 1: Combine ingredients

In a medium bowl, mix together the chocolate-hazelnut spread, mascarpone c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until well combined. Set aside.

Assembling the Ravioli

Step 1: Roll out the dough

Divide the rested dough into four equal parts. On a lightly floured surface, roll out one piece of dough at a time into a thin rectangle, about 1/8-inch thick.

Step 2: Place the filling

Drop teaspoon-sized amounts of the filling onto the dough, spacing them about 2 inches apart.

Step 3: Fold and seal

Fold the dough over the filling to create a long, filled rectangle. Press the edges of the dough together, sealing in the filling. Use a fluted pastry wheel or a sharp knife to cut the ravioli into individual squares.

Step 4: Repeat

Continue the process with the remaining dough and filling. Place the finished ravioli on a floured baking sheet, making sure they don’t touch each other.

Cooking the Ravioli

Step 1: Boil water

Bring a large pot of water to a rolling boil. Add a pinch of salt to the water.

Step 2: Cook the ravioli

Gently lower the ravioli into the boiling water, being careful not to overcrowd the pot. Cook for about 3-4 minutes, or until the ravioli float to the surface. Use a slotted spoon to remove the ravioli from the water, and drain on paper towels.

Garnishing and Serving

In a small bowl, mix together the powdered sugar and cocoa powder. Lightly dust the cooked ravioli with the cocoa-powdered sugar mixture, ensuring each ravioli is well coated.

Serve the Chocolate-Hazelnut Ravioli immediately, either as a dessert or as a unique treat for a special occasion. You can also offer a side of whipped cream or a scoop of vanilla ice cream for an even more indulgent experience.

Tips and Variations

  • For a festive touch, consider adding a splash of orange liqueur or espresso to the filling mixture.
  • You can also incorporate finely chopped toasted hazelnuts into the filling for added texture and flavor.
  • If you’re short on time, use store-bought wonton wrappers instead of making the dough from scratch.
  • The uncooked ravioli can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ours, or in the freezer for up to 1 month. Cook them straight from the fridge or freezer, adding an additional minute to the cooking time if frozen.
